Hi there everyone from a first time poster :-)

 

I would love someone's advice on this Forum.about my current problems with payment of Council Tax at the moment. We are up to date on our payments as they stand for this year. :-)

 

On Wednesday, I received a letter stating that I was in arrears for my Council Tax. The reason for this was because I had not paid the monthly payment on the exact date ...the 7th of the month to be precise (we pay the post office per month rather than use a Direct Debit - my partner hates direct debits). I pay the Council Tax when it suits me.... but I always pay no matter what :-x

 

The letter said we had to pay £121 pounds x 4 on Dec 2011 and.Jan, Feb, Mar 2012 on top of our monthly payment of £138.00 - what a cheek!!

 

I rang up the Council people and they explained to me why I was fined, and I was shocked about the way they have slammed a lot of extra costs on me as they consider necessary due to the late payments as part of a Court issue.

They said the late payment are attached with legal reprecussons to my partner and myself if we refuse to pay. :shock:

The first payment of £121 is wanted on the 1/12/2011, and the council insisted we pay by direct Debit - I said my partner hates Direct Debits and that is how it ia, and will remain that way.

 

Can anyone advise me about my rights as I feel that the extra £500 a year... is a cheek to say the least - like I am made of money not. Talk about jobs worth.

 

I am originally from Scotland where the laws for paying council tax are very different as I am finding out to my cost. :mad2:

 

I am thinking of going to CAB but time is against me as we are busy solid for the next week.

 

Please could someone advise if my legal rights can by used to prevent these stupid additional payments that I feel are not due at all. :jaw:

 

Look forward to hearing people views about this, and if anyone else has been taken to the cleaners for the same issues, and if they resolved it!

Council Tax is due on the 1 April each year in full. As a dispensation the Council may allow you to pay in instalments over 10 months or so. If paying by any other method than Direct Debit then again this will be due on the 1st of the month and in cleared funds. If paying at the Post Office this may take approx 5 working days to reach your CT Account at the Council - so if due on the 1st you should really pay approx 1 week earlier than this. Some Councils will give a little leeway others will not and can be very strict.

 

They will write to you and ask that payments be brought up to date within 7 days, if that is not done they then have the authority to suspend all future instalments and insist on full payment for the rest of the year within another 7 days. Failure to carry this out may result in them applying to the local Magistrates Court for a Liability Order against you which can carry the threats of enforcement - Attachment of Earnings/Benefits, Bailiffs, Charging Order, Bankruptcy or Imprisonment.

 

You need to find out exactly how much CT is outstanding and what sort of action the Council have taken against you, ring them Monday and ask.
